Understanding the Chicken Road Casino Gameplay
At its core, the chicken road casino game is incredibly straightforward. A chicken embarks on a road, and with each step it takes, a multiplier increases. The player’s strategic aim is to cash out before the chicken inevitably meets its unfortunate end – typically by colliding with an obstacle. The longer the chicken survives, the higher the multiplier, and consequently, the larger the potential payout. The game offers a compelling blend of suspense and strategic timing.

Return to Player (RTP) and Game Fairness
A key factor to consider when evaluating any online casino game is its Return to Player (RTP) percentage. The RTP represents the long-term average payout percentage – the amount of money returned to players over a vast number of rounds. In the case of the chicken road casino, the RTP is impressively high at 98%. This means that, on average, players can expect to receive back £98 for every £100 wagered over the long run.
- High RTP increases winning possibilities.
- The higher the RTP, the lower the house edge.
- Players might need patience for the value to show.
However, it’s important to remember that RTP is a theoretical calculation. In any given session, outcomes can vary significantly due to the inherent randomness of the game. A high RTP doesn’t guarantee immediate winnings, but it does provide reassurance that the game is generally fair and offers a reasonable chance of recouping one’s wagers.
Maximum Payout Potential and Betting Limits
The chicken road casino offers a potentially lucrative maximum payout of £20,000. This substantial prize is achievable on the ‘Hard’ and ‘Hardcore’ difficulty levels when the multiplier reaches x100. However, reaching such a high multiplier is rare and requires a combination of luck and skillful timing. The game caters to a wide range of players through its flexible betting limits.
- Minimum bet is £0.01 per round.
- Maximum bet per round is £200.
- Maximum payout is capped at £20,000.
This wide range allows both casual players with smaller bankrolls and high rollers to participate. While the prospect of a £20,000 win is enticing, it’s essential to approach the game responsibly.
